Unfortunately you cannot visit the lighthouse. Nevertheless this place is worth to visit. From there you can have a nice little walk along the coast, or during low tide you just climb on the rocks. Th...
This path deserves a nice sight of peace. A semaphore, a fort, a beach port, full of excuses for making beautiful small walks. You can sleep in the fort.
For a beautiful walk or bathing. See the fort, the headlight, the port, the beaches. Possible in camping car or with dogs. Flat, accessible to all. Finish with a glass or a meal on the scale.
